Nature Methods (@naturemethods) 's Twitter Profile Photo

Organic dyes can photoconvert, having unexpected effects on quantitative microscopy. Check out this lovely paper from the Carravilla and Eggeling labs on how photoblueing impacts confocal, STED, and FLIM experiments, and how exchangeable probes can help! nature.com/articles/s4159…

EMBL (@embl) 's Twitter Profile Photo

Ever wondered how cells regulate the molecular traffic in and out of their nuclei? New research from Texas A&M University, supported by MINFLUX experts from the EMBL Imaging Centre, is helping uncover how molecules navigate the nuclear pore complex. embl.org/news/science-t…
